How Onstar 4mg Tablet MD works:
MD Onstar 4mg tablets are an anti-vomiting drug. Their mechanism involves inhibiting serotonin, a neurotransmitter in the brain that can trigger nausea and vomiting associated with cancer therapy (chemotherapy) or post-operative recovery.

What if you forget to take Onstar 4mg Tablet MD :
Should you forget to take your 4mg Onstar Tablet MD, administer it at your earliest convenience.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
